Public debate begins on the 'Higgs factory,' Europe's future particle accelerator
The future circular collider at CERN, intended to probe the properties of the Higgs boson in 20 years' time, excites physicists. Yet its construction, beneath the surface of France and Switzerland, is certain to impact the environment and local residents. For that reason, a public debate on this colossal project begins on June 2 and will continue for several months.
